Abstract
The purpose of the article was to substantiate the importance of emotional development as an educational task. The need to solve a wide range of problems sets the problem of studying the potential of the individual, in which emotions play a special role. The development of emotions as a function of the psyche should become an important pedagogical task.
The phenomenon of emotional development with an emphasis on dynamic characteristics is described. Emotional development proceeds in stages. Emotion has a source of movement. The stage-by-stage process of complication and improvement of emotional forms and content, which has a driving force, characterized by determinism, consistency and complementarity of content aspects is shown.
The phased nature of the flow of emotions, the presence of a source of movement determine the intermediate and included status of emotional phenomena accompanying cognitive processes, motivation, perception and formation of values, meaning creation.
In the course of the educational process, it is necessary to progressively teach a person to develop and use the potential of emotions for solving various problems.
